Established: 2006
Type: Private University
Location: Binh Dinh Province, Vietnam
Campus Address: Quy Nhon City, Binh Dinh Province, Central Vietnam
Quang Trung University is located in Quy Nhon, a coastal city known for its natural beauty and growing importance as a regional educational hub. The university plays a significant role in providing educational opportunities for students in the central and southern regions of Vietnam.

Most programs at QTU are taught in Vietnamese, so international students who do not speak the language may need to take Vietnamese language courses before starting their degree programs.
Some programs may offer English-taught courses (especially in business or language studies), but the availability of these should be confirmed directly with the university.

On-Campus Dormitories:
Quang Trung University offers on-campus accommodation for both domestic and international students. These dormitories are typically shared rooms with basic amenities such as Wi-Fi, communal bathrooms, and kitchens.
Cost: Around $50 – $100 per month, depending on the type of accommodation and room-sharing arrangement.
Off-Campus Housing:
International students can also rent private apartments or shared housing near the university. Quy Nhon is a relatively affordable city, and students can find suitable housing options close to campus.
Cost: Around $200 – $400 per month, depending on the size and location of the apartment.

Academic Qualifications:
Applicants must have completed high school or an equivalent secondary education program that is recognized by the Vietnamese Ministry of Education and Training (MOET).
International students must have a high school diploma equivalent to the Vietnamese standard, as recognized by MOET.
Entrance Examination:
Domestic students often apply based on their Vietnam National University Entrance Exam results.
International students may not be required to take the national entrance exam, but they must submit academic transcripts and other qualifications for review.
Language Proficiency:
Vietnamese-taught programs:
Vietnamese language proficiency is required for international students applying to Vietnamese-taught programs. Students who do not speak Vietnamese may need to enroll in a Vietnamese language course before beginning their academic program.
English-taught programs:
For programs taught in English (if available), applicants must meet the English proficiency requirements. Accepted language tests include:
IELTS: Minimum score of 5.5
TOEFL iBT: Minimum score of 61

Academic Qualifications:
A bachelor’s degree in a relevant field from a recognized university is required.
International students must have a bachelor’s degree equivalent to a Vietnamese bachelor’s degree as recognized by the Vietnamese Ministry of Education and Training (MOET).
Work Experience (if applicable):
For programs like the Master of Business Administration (MBA), applicants may need 1-2 years of relevant work experience. This requirement may vary based on the program and the applicant’s academic background.
Language Proficiency:
English-taught programs:
For international students applying to the MBA or other English-taught graduate programs, an IELTS score of at least 6.0 or a TOEFL iBT score of at least 79 is generally required.
Vietnamese-taught programs:
International students must provide proof of Vietnamese language proficiency for programs conducted in Vietnamese. If needed, students can take a preparatory Vietnamese language course.

Address:
Quang Trung University, Nguyen Tat Thanh Avenue, An Phu Ward, Quy Nhon City, Binh Dinh Province, Vietnam.
Proximity to City Center:
The university is located just a few kilometers from the Quy Nhon city center, which offers students easy access to various amenities such as shopping centers, restaurants, cafes, and public transport.
Coastal Environment:
Quy Nhon is a coastal city, meaning students can enjoy beautiful beaches and waterfront views. The proximity to the ocean provides a calm and relaxed atmosphere, ideal for studying and enjoying leisure activities.
Transportation:
Quy Nhon is well-connected by public transportation. Students can use local buses, motorbike taxis (xe ôm), and ride-sharing services to get around the city.
The city is accessible from major cities like Ho Chi Minh City and Hanoi via Phu Cat Airport, which is about 30 km from the city center.
Cultural and Historical Significance:
Quy Nhon is home to various historical landmarks, such as the ancient Cham Towers and other historical ruins, which give students a rich cultural experience during their stay.
Affordable Living Costs:
Compared to major cities like Hanoi and Ho Chi Minh City, Quy Nhon offers a much lower cost of living, making it affordable for both domestic and international students.
